Syracuse's next Mayor: She's a lady!


Ellen Leahy 11/04/09More articles
Herm Card's capture of Stephanie Miner high fiving after her victory in the campaign for Mayor of the city of Syracuse.
After an eight month campaign, yet looking fresh as a daisy, an energetic Stephanie Miner took the podium at the University Sheraton Hotel. As Syracuse's next Mayor she promised to "work hard everyday to insure that you have a mayor in city hall that you will be proud of."

After thanking friends and family, she properly addressed her position as the first female mayor of Syracuse by thanking all the grandmothers, aunts, great aunts and sisters who encouraged her to rise to her full potential.

She then thanked all the men, who were smart enough to get involved with "temperamental women," effectively embracing a handle that had been attached to her by rivals during the campaign. She also thanked her opponents by their first names, Otis (Jennings) and Steve (Kimatian).

She asked Jennings, Kimatian and residents of the city, whether they had voted for her or not, to come together and help her administration to restore Syracuse to a city of justice, a city of peace and a city of hope for all its residents.
